Find evidence to back your assertion
You will need evidence to back your claim, regardless of whether you are filing a personal or other kind of claim for injury. Based on the specifics of your case, you might require the assistance of an attorney to assist with this process.
An experienced attorney can help you to gather all of the evidence you need to support your case. This includes gathering evidence and statements from other individuals. To find additional evidence, your attorney can also seek out experts like doctors. A knowledgeable lawyer will help make the entire process more efficient and successful.
Also, take photographs of the accident site. These pictures will allow you to show your injuries and the severity of your damage. Other people will be able see the scene of the accident and help them understand it. Even in the absence of an attorney, you can capture photos and save them. However, you should always have backup copies.
Documenting physical evidence , such as scratches on the vehicle, clothing or other equipment is crucial. Documenting this evidence immediately after an accident is the best way to collect it. If you're unable to document the physical evidence, you are able to get a decent amount of proof with circumstantial evidence. You can be successful and receive the amount you deserve for your services by having evidence in your possession.

Court costs and other litigation expenses
Attorneys' fees for injury cases are often substantial, particularly when the case is complex. They include legal fees administration expenses and expert witness costs and disbursements. Some of these costs can't be avoided.
Attorney's fees can range from hundreds to thousands of dollars. You could be charged expert witness fees and court reporter fees. Transcripts and travel costs may also be included in your attorney's fees. You may have to engage an accident reconstructionist, doctor, or other experts to defend your case. Based on the extent of your injuries, you may pay hundreds of dollars for investigation, deposition, and trial preparation.
Other costs include the copying and faxing of documents. Firms usually keep track on copies and faxes, and then bill clients for each. A transcript can range between $2 and $4 per webpage.
